Die Mönche des Shaolin Kung Fu
On March 24, 2026, the legendary monks of Shaolin Kung Fu finally return to Kufstein after years of absence. In the Stadtsaal Kufstein, they will present their international hit production “Shami's Journey to Shaolin” as part of their grand European tour. The show is a fascinating blend of centuries-old martial arts, spiritual depth, and breathtaking physical mastery. For over 1,500 years, the Shaolin temple in China has been regarded as the cradle of Zen Buddhism and the origin of Kung Fu. With incredible precision, strength, and inner calm, the monks demonstrate their skills in Hard Qi Gong, smashing sticks and iron rods on their bodies, and showing seemingly superhuman control over mind and matter – a spectacle that inspires both awe and wonder. Accompanied by impressive video footage from the original temple in China, the production tells the inspiring story of the young student Shami, who embarks on a journey to discover the true meaning of discipline, courage, and inner mastery. The audience is actively engaged in the performance and experiences firsthand simple Shaolin breathing techniques that make the essence of this ancient teaching tangible.
